Parking lot striping involves painting bright and strong lines that separate parking stalls, create routes, and mark special zones like handicap-accessible spaces and fire lanes. These markings not only assist drivers but also help companies look more polished. Over time, however, weather, heavy traffic, and constant wear force those lines to fade, making it harder for people to see where to park. The Importance of Professional Parking Lot Striping
Many people think striping a parking lot is as simple as getting some paint and making lines. The truth is, it needs the right gear, high-quality materials, and knowledge to get the job completed correctly. Professional line striping companies are trained to measure areas, create straight and balanced lines, and apply markings that follow local regulations. For example, handicap parking spaces must be painted with the correct size, symbols, and shades to meet accessibility standards. Fire lanes also need to be brightly marked so emergency vehicles can get through quickly when needed.The process begins with planning. Experts create a layout that makes the optimal use of the available space, allowing the maximum number of cars to park without creating unsafe or dangerous spots. Once the layout is ready, they work with water-based acrylic traffic paints, which are the most frequent type of paint for striping today. This paint is durable, environmentally friendly, and dries quickly, meaning drivers can use the lot soon after the job is completed.
Another key feature of skilled parking lot striping is directional arrows. These arrows tell drivers where to go in, exit, and move through the lot securely. Without them, cars may move the wrong way, leading to trouble and potential accidents. Brightly painted arrows, along with clear stall lines, make parking lots safer for both car owners and pedestrians.

Regular Maintenance Keeps Parking Lots Safe and Organized
Parking lot striping doesn’t last always. Rain, sun, snow, and constant traffic slowly erode the paint. Over time, the bright lines that once looked clear begin to fade, making it difficult for drivers to tell where to park. This can result to cars taking up too much area, blocked fire lanes, or confusion about traffic direction.
